0

プロジェクトに django-rosetta をインストールしました。.po および .mo ファイルを作成しました。テンプレートには、django-rosetta (django docs から) で既に翻訳されたテキストを示すコードがあります。翻訳された各ページへのリンクを作成するにはどうすればよいですか?

{% get_current_language as LANGUAGE_CODE %}
    <!-- Current language: {{ LANGUAGE_CODE }} -->
    <p>{% trans "Welcome to our page" %}</p>
    <p>{{ LANGUAGE_CODE }}</p>

    {% language 'pl' %}
        {% get_current_language as LANGUAGE_CODE %}
        <p>{% trans "Some text to translate" %}</p>
    {% endlanguage %}

    {% language 'en' %}
        {% get_current_language as LANGUAGE_CODE %}
        <p>{% trans "Some text to translate" %}</p>
    {% endlanguage %}

    {% language 'ru' %}
        {% get_current_language as LANGUAGE_CODE %}
        <p>{% trans "Some text to translate" %}</p>
    {% endlanguage %}
4

0 に答える 0